This book is the second daily devotion book that I have written for regular daily use on Facebook. As such, it is very similar to the first devotion book that I wrote for Facebook. The main difference, however, is that many of the devotions in this book are based on some of the other books that I have also written. For example, some of the devotions are based on the characters that were identified in my book entitled "A Guide for Life Is God for Life." Some are based on the book "Twenty-one Steps to Living One's Best Life." Some are based on the book "The Apostate Church Will Soon Be Here." Some are based on the book "Marriage and How to Have a Godly Home." Some are based on the book "Becoming a Christian and Living a Blessed Life." So by bringing those ideas into this book, one can get small glimpses of Bible truth in brief one-page summaries rather than having to read through the entire book upon which many of these daily devotions have been based.

That might be very helpful since so many people are so busy. The most important thing for any person in this life is to come to Jesus through faith in the right spirit and with the right attitude to be saved. After that, the second most important thing is to serve the Lord however He is leading. Therefore, it is hoped that this book will be a daily help as people try to do those two things. It is also hoped that the Lord will be honored, praised, and glorified by this presentation of His Word. The Bible should be each person's handbook for daily living. It is the most important and clearly most profitable book ever written. II Timothy 3:16-17 says, "All scripture is given by inspiration of God, and is profitable for doctrine, for reproof, for correction, for instruction in righteousness: That the man of God may be perfect, throughly furnished unto all good works." So read it. Enjoy it. Live by its never-failing principles.

Now before concluding this Introduction, there is still one more important thing to share. It is that from a spiritual perspective, one might say that all people can be divided into the three groupings of J-O-Y, Y-O-J, or just Y. That being the case, it is the belief of this author that the most content and most satisfied people in all the world are the J-O-Y's. The least content and least satisfied are the Y-O-J's. The unhappiest and most miserable individuals are the Y's. So who are the J-O-Y's, the Y-O-J's, and the Y's? They are the individuals whom Jesus identified in Matthew 22:37-39. Those verses say, "…Thou shalt love the Lord thy God with all thy heart, and with all thy soul, and with all thy mind. This is the first and great commandment. And the second is like unto it, Thou shalt love thy neighbour as thyself."

So based upon those verses, the letter "J" stands for Jesus. The letter "O" stands for others. The letter "Y" stands for yourself. So putting it all together, the most content, most satisfied people in this world are those who consistently put Jesus first, others second, and themselves last (J-O-Y). For example, the medical report is not so good. J-O-Y. The car breaks down. J-O-Y. This is not a really great day. J-O-Y. I did not want that to happen. J-O-Y. But the unhappiest and most miserable individuals in this world are the Y-O-J's and the Y's because they consistently put themselves before everyone else and everything else. So this devotion book has been written to try to daily encourage everyone to be a J-O-Y. That means that a good response to every situation in life is J-O-Y no matter how unpleasant the circumstance.
